
Adult Time Debuts New Isiah Maxwell Series 'Heart Beats'
MONTREAL — Adult Time has released the pilot episode of XBIZ Award winner Isiah Maxwell's new series, "Heart Beats."
The episode, which Maxwell directed and co-wrote with Adult Time CCO Bree Mills, stars Gal Ritchie and Charles Dera.
"'Heart Beats' explores the intricate dynamics and private moments of straight couples, offering viewers a deep dive into the emotional highs and lows of their relationships through flashbacks and pivotal experiences to reveal the intensity of their initial attraction, the conflicts they face and the ultimate closure they see," said a rep.
Maxwell enthused about the project.
"'Heart Beats' is a close-to-chest project that challenges storytelling ability through adult erotic scenes," he said. "I enjoy writing in a sense that leaves open a conversation and creates a constructive dialogue that challenges the ideas I present. I cannot thank Bree and the Adult Time production team enough for helping me develop it."
Added Mills, "I love many things about Isiah’s concept. But my standouts are how he weaved the sex throughout the story and his ambitious vision to encapsulate the lifetime of a relationship within a single episode. Very excited to see how Adult Time subscribers react to this pilot."
The episode is streaming on AdultTime.
